vivo X200 FE PH launch confirmed for July 18; price leaks hint at over P40K

In Phones by Ramon LopezLeave a Comment

Just last month, vivo unveiled its latest compact sub-flagship, the vivo X200 FE, to a global audience, with initial launches in Asian markets like Taiwan, Malaysia, and Thailand.

Now, we have confirmation that the phone is officially making its way to the Philippines later this month, with a launch date set for July 18. Even better, we’ve caught wind of its potential domestic pricing. Based on posts we’ve found online, the vivo X200 FE could retail for P43,999, or roughly $781 converted, for the variant packing 12GB of physical RAM and 512GB of onboard storage. And while this isn’t an official figure from vivo just yet — meaning the final price could be lower or even higher — we’re hoping for a more competitive tag when the X200 series unit officially drops.

By contrast, the same configuration of the FE model goes for NTD26,999 ($930 or P52,366) in Taiwan and HK$5,498 ($700 or P39,452) in Hong Kong. And for even more context, consider that Xiaomi’s POCO F7 with a much more capable Qualcomm Snapdragon 8s Gen 4 processor and the same battery capacity starts at P23,999 ($426) — or almost half the price — at local retail.

Still, compared to its siblings, the vivo X200 and vivo X200 Pro, which sport MediaTek’s newer Dimensity 9400 platform, and Philippine prices of P57,999 ($1,030) and P69,999 ($1,243), respectively, the vivo X200 FE looks much more appealing from a value standpoint. That more palatable price, however, comes with a few spec compromises. The most notable is the Dimensity 9300 Plus chipset, a last-generation chip also found in the vivo T4 Ultra 5G.

To recap, the vivo X200 FE features a vibrant 6.31-inch LTPO OLED display with 120Hz refresh rate and a claimed peak brightness of 5,000 nits. Despite its slender 7.99mm profile and a manageable 186-gram weight, the brand also managed to integrate a massive 6,500mAh silicon-carbon battery, which is reportedly good for up to 25 hours of continuous YouTube playback or 9.5 hours of continuous gaming. When it’s time to recharge, the included 90-watt fast charger promises to take the battery from zero to 100% in just 57 minutes.

The rear-facing camera setup on the FE version is equally compelling, boasting a Zeiss-backed lens system. The main shooter is a 50-megapixel sensor with an f/1.88 aperture and optical image stabilization. It’s accompanied by a 50-megapixel telephoto lens and an 8-megapixel ultrawide sensor, offering versatility for various shooting scenarios. For your selfie needs, there’s a capable 50-megapixel camera up front.
